Barbecued Chicken

40 minutes Prep: 15 minutes Cook: 25 minutes
28 calories per serving view nutrition facts

Ingredients

4x chicken breasts boneless and skinless
For the sauce
1/4cup ketchup low sodium
3tablespoons cider vinegar
1tablespoon horseradish sauce
2teaspoons brown sugar firmly packed
1clove garlic minced
1/8teaspoon thyme dried
1/4teaspoon black pepper

Directions

1. Preheat broiler, heat a charcoal grill until coals form white ash, or preheat a gas grill to medium.

2. To prepare sauce, in a small saucepan, combine ketchup, vinegar, horseradish, brown sugar, garlic and thyme.

Mix well.

Bring to a boil over medium-low heat.

Cook, stirring frequently, until thickened, about 5 minutes.

Remove from heat; stir in pepper.

3. Brush tops of chicken pieces lightly with sauce.

Place chicken, sauce-side down, on a foil-lined broiler pan or grill rack.

Brush other sides lightly with sauce.

4. Broil or grill 3 inches from heat, basting with remaining sauce and turning until no longer pink in center, about 5 to 7 minutes per side.

Let chicken stand for 5 minutes before serving.
